#333ba1 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#333ba1 is composed of 20% red, 23.1% green and 63.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 68.3% cyan, 63.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 36.9% black. It has a hue angle of 235.6 degrees, a saturation of 51.9% and a lightness of 41.6%. #333ba1 color hex could be obtained by blending #6676ff with #000043. Closest websafe color is: #333399.

● #333ba1 color description : Dark moderate blue.
#333ba1 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#333ba1 has RGB values of R:51, G:59, B:161 and CMYK values of C:0.68, M:0.63, Y:0, K:0.37. Its decimal value is 3357601.

Shades and Tints of #333ba1
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#04040c is the darkest color, while #fcfcf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#333ba1
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#646570 is the less saturated color, while #0211d2 is the most saturated one.
